  • What wildlife can be spotted near cabins in Texas?

    Wildlife sightings near Texas cabins vary greatly depending on location. In the Hill Country, you might see deer, armadillos, and various bird species. Further west, you could encounter coyotes, rabbits, and even the occasional bobcat. Near rivers and lakes, expect to see various types of birds, turtles, and possibly even some snakes. Always maintain a safe distance from any wildlife and never approach or feed them.

  • When is the most favourable weather for outdoor activities in Texas?

    The best time for outdoor activities in Texas is generally spring (March-May) and autumn (September-November). Temperatures are mild and pleasant during these seasons, making it ideal for hiking, exploring national parks, and enjoying other outdoor pursuits. Summer (June-August) can be extremely hot and humid, while winter (December-February) can be chilly, particularly in the northern parts of the state.

  • What are the must-visit natural attractions in Texas?

    Texas boasts incredible natural beauty. Big Bend National Park, with its dramatic mountains and desert landscapes, is a must-see. Guadalupe Mountains National Park offers challenging hikes with stunning views. For stunning coastal scenery, visit Padre Island National Seashore. Within driving distance of Austin, you can find the beautiful natural swimming holes of Hamilton Pool Preserve.

  • What local meals should be on my list in Texas?

    Tex-Mex is a must-try! Don't miss out on delicious fajitas, enchiladas, and tacos. Barbecue is another Texas staple, with various styles across the state. Try brisket, ribs, or sausage at a local barbecue joint. For something different, sample chili, a hearty and flavourful dish. And don't forget to try some pecan pie for dessert!
